James R. Thornwell was an American Army Private who, in 1961, was administered LSD without his knowledge during an interrogation by the U.S. Army. In 1978, after learning he had been dosed, Thornwell filed a $10 million lawsuit against the U.S. government, which was ultimately settled for $625,000. He died of an apparent epileptic seizure in 1984, at the age of 46.
